Byram is a small but growing town located in Hinds County, Mississippi. It is a suburb of the state’s capital, Jackson, and is part of the Jackson Metropolitan Statistical Area. The town was originally known as “Byram’s” in honor of its founder, A.M. Byram, who donated land for the construction of a railroad depot in the late 1800s. The town has since dropped the possessive form and is now simply known as Byram.

Byram is a close-knit community with a population of around 11,000 residents. Despite its small size, the town has been experiencing steady population growth in recent years, as more people are attracted to its affordable housing, good schools, and rural charm. Many families and young professionals have chosen to make Byram their home due to its proximity to Jackson and the opportunities the larger city provides.

The town is known for its beautiful parks and outdoor recreational opportunities. The Byram Swinging Bridge Park is a popular spot for picnicking, fishing, and enjoying the picturesque views of the Pearl River. The Byram Trails offer a scenic escape for hikers and bikers, with several miles of well-maintained trails winding through the town’s natural surroundings.

Byram also has a strong sense of community spirit, with events such as the annual Swinging Bridge Festival and Fourth of July celebrations bringing residents together for fun and fellowship. The town’s community center is a hub of activity, hosting events, classes, and community meetings.

In terms of education, Byram is served by the Hinds County School District, which includes several elementary, middle, and high schools. The town is also home to the Hinds Community College – Rankin Campus, providing residents with access to higher education and vocational training.
